寶塔Docker安裝nps


寶塔Docker安裝nps

其他安裝教程

docker安裝教程如下:

nps的客戶端npc

使用方式

1、拉取nps鏡像

docker pull ffdfgdfg/nps

2、創建nps掛載文件目錄(自己隨意設置)

mkdir -p /mnt/sdc/nps/conf

3、從github上拉取conf文件信息

https://github.com/ehang-io/nps/tree/master/conf

4、上傳conf文件的內容到剛創建好的掛載目錄

5、修改nps.conf文件 主要修改一些端口

appname = nps
runmode = dev

http_proxy_ip=0.0.0.0
http_proxy_port=19000
https_proxy_port=19001
https_just_proxy=true

https_default_cert_file=conf/server.pem
https_default_key_file=conf/server.key

bridge_type=tcp
bridge_port=19002
bridge_ip=0.0.0.0

public_vkey=123

log_level=7

web_host=a.o.com
web_username=admin
web_password=admin
web_port = 19003
web_ip=0.0.0.0
web_base_url=
web_open_ssl=false
web_cert_file=conf/server.pem
web_key_file=conf/server.key
auth_crypt_key =1234567887654321
allow_user_login=false
allow_user_register=false
allow_user_change_username=false
allow_flow_limit=false
allow_rate_limit=false
allow_tunnel_num_limit=false
allow_local_proxy=false
allow_connection_num_limit=false
allow_multi_ip=false
system_info_display=false
http_cache=false
http_cache_length=100
http_add_origin_header=false

6、啟動nps,設置對外映射的端口區間

docker run -d -p 19000-19010:19000-19010 -v /mnt/sdc/nps/conf:/conf --name=nps ffdfgdfg/nps

7、放行寶塔和服務器端口

19000-19010

7、訪問你的服務器ip

 http://ip:19003/login/index

默認的登錄賬戶密碼:admin:admin

8、創建客戶端查看-server和 -vkey

9、創建tcp隧道綁定創建的客戶端編號

10、下載nps客戶端的服務,修改npc.conf文件 ,設置 -server 和-vkey的值

11、啟動退出當前目錄,啟動npc服務,即可實現內網穿透

原文:https://blog.csdn.net/weixin_44392841/article/details/105926946


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M